    I have made some updates to my skin files (see first post).
    • Minor updates for MovingPictures 1.0.2 (beta 3)
    • Fixed problems with video and music overlays
    • Cleaner look for filmstrip view
    • Working on a more consistent look between MovingPictures and TVSeries
    • Consolidated images between MovingPictures and TVSeries
    • Changed media image files to white logos with black borders
    I will be posting my TVSeries 2.5 files (for Monochrome 2.9) for those interested when I finish testing them, there's a lot more screens there so I want to make sure I didn't miss anything.
